Hole in the wall Chinese food restaurant located next to Savers in the Waipahu Shopping Plaza. Heard about the $5.99 breakfast special before 10am with fried rice, 2 eggs, 2spam, 2port sausage, 2 bacon and mac salad so had to tryπŸ€™

Arrived there maybe about 15 minutes after it opened and line was packed. Ordered 2 breakfast special and 6 pork hash to go. Lady said there was 10 people ahead of me so no problem... Worth the wait for 2 breakfast specials and 6 pork hash for $22.

Took maybe about 15 minutes, got the order and took it home. Food looked better than it tasted. Eggs overcooked, mac salad watery and mushy (didnt eat) and fried rice dry and tasteless. Meats were good, ended up throwing half the plate away:(

Pork hash was good for the price but ive had better. Maybe for the price of the breakfast special its cheap eats but ill pay more for better quality. 3 stars.
